Output 3de21d60a3fe081a9e2a2cc177944b4e5d020494bfc8b441bbd51892cf6d4d3f:0

value
4275088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ee9e47ece24415ca141f149da23f004b1d72b262 OP_EQUAL
address
3PSiMkdwZeLMbBn2jKZty9P8Zx7bkM85my
transaction
3de21d60a3fe081a9e2a2cc177944b4e5d020494bfc8b441bbd51892cf6d4d3f
confirmations
205577
spent
true